A strong fit

When this is the right choice

Crypto exchanges and VASP operators
The Seychelles FSA has issued VASP registrations to major global exchanges including Binance and BitMEX at various points. For crypto businesses seeking a reputable offshore regulatory address, Seychelles is a well-trodden path with predictable timelines.
Offshore fund managers and investment advisors
Seychelles offers securities dealer and investment advisor licences under a proportionate regulatory framework. Fund structures, including segregated portfolio companies, are well-supported under Seychelles corporate law.
FX brokers and derivatives platforms
Seychelles FSA-licensed securities dealers can operate FX and derivatives businesses serving international clients from a recognised offshore base, at significantly lower cost and overhead than an EU or tier-1 jurisdiction.
A poor fit

When to consider an alternative

Operators needing EU or institutional banking access
A Seychelles licence alone does not satisfy EU regulatory equivalence requirements. Operators requiring EU payment processor relationships, MiCA compliance, or institutional banking typically need to layer a Seychelles structure with an EU-regulated entity.
Operators targeting retail clients in major regulated markets
Seychelles FSA regulation is not recognised in the UK, EU, US, or Australia for retail market access. Marketing to retail clients in these markets on the basis of a Seychelles licence exposes operators to significant regulatory risk.
Businesses that require tier-1 reputational credibility
Seychelles sits in the offshore tier alongside Vanuatu, BVI, and Anjouan. It is credible for institutional and sophisticated investor client bases, but does not carry the same commercial weight as MGA, UKGC, or FINMA.
02 — Licence categories

Permissions under
one Act.

Choosing the right tier and scope is the most consequential decision in the application.

Virtual Asset Service Provider (VASP)

Seychelles VASP registration covers crypto exchange, OTC, and custody services. The FSA introduced its VASP framework in 2022 and has become a recognised offshore VASP jurisdiction used by major exchanges.

Securities Dealer Licence

Covers FX brokerage, derivatives dealing, and investment advisory services for international clients. The primary licence for offshore FX and CFD brokers using Seychelles as their regulatory base.

International Corporate Service Provider

Covers trust, corporate service, and fund administration functions. Used by Seychelles-based entities providing offshore company formation, nominee, and fiduciary services to international clients.

03 — Path to grant

Phases to licence grant.

Seychelles entity incorporation

Week 1—2

International Business Company (IBC) or Special Licence Company (CSL) incorporated in Seychelles. Registered agent appointed, share capital deposited, and UBO documentation prepared.

Application preparation

Weeks 2—4

FSA application assembled: business plan, AML/CFT policies, KYC procedures, management CVs, source of funds, and operating capital evidence.

FSA review

Weeks 4—6

FSA reviews application documentation and may request clarifications. For VASP applications, technology documentation including platform security overview is typically required.

Licence grant

Weeks 6—8

FSA licence issued. Annual renewal obligations, AML reporting, and financial returns activated. VASP licensees subject to ongoing AML supervision.

04 — Year-one economics

Cost and regulatory
burden.

Year-one spend is dominated by substance — resident director, office, compliance officer, external audit — not the licence fee itself.

Cost itemAmount
FSA application fee USD 1,000 — 3,000
Annual licence fee USD 2,000 — 8,000
Seychelles IBC incorporation USD 1,500 — 3,000
Registered agent (annual) USD 1,500 — 3,000
AML/compliance advisory USD 5,000 — 15,000 / yr
Year-1 total ~USD 20K — 50K

Seychelles is one of the most cost-efficient offshore jurisdictions for financial services and VASP licensing. Operating capital (USD 50K) is the primary upfront commitment. Annual running costs are minimal compared to onshore EU alternatives — making Seychelles an effective offshore layer in multi-jurisdictional structures.

An International Business Company (IBC) is the standard offshore vehicle — no Seychelles tax on foreign-source income, no local activity required, and private ownership. A Special Licence Company (CSL) is used when the company needs to conduct local Seychelles business and benefits from a 1.5% preferential tax rate.
Yes — Seychelles is commonly used as the regulatory base for exchanges primarily serving Asian, LATAM, and African markets. The FSA's VASP framework provides a recognised regulatory address, and the jurisdiction's neutrality and offshore status suit operators not targeting EU or North American retail clients.
Yes. Seychelles adopted FATF-compliant AML legislation and the FSA enforces AML/CFT obligations on all licensees. KYC at client onboarding, ongoing transaction monitoring, STR filing, and beneficial ownership disclosure are all mandatory.
IBCs have no Seychelles income tax on foreign-source income. CSLs are taxed at 1.5% on taxable income. There is no capital gains tax, withholding tax on dividends, or inheritance tax. This makes Seychelles one of the most tax-efficient offshore structures available.
Seychelles is faster and cheaper to establish than BVI or Mauritius but carries slightly less regulatory weight than Mauritius FSC. For crypto-specific VASP licensing, Seychelles has become more prominent than BVI since introducing its dedicated VASP framework. For fund structures, Mauritius is generally preferred for Indian market access, while Seychelles suits global-facing funds.
